SANAA, July 28 (YPA) – Thunderstorms of varying intensity will be fallen on vast parts of the provinces of Yemen, the National Center of Meteorology and Early Warning predicted on Monday.
The center affirmed in its weather forecast, the scattered rains may fall on the provinces of Saada, Hajjah, Mahweet, Amran, Sanaa, Rayma, Dhamar, Ibb, Taiz, Dhalea, Bayda, western Jawf, the highlands of Abyan, Shabwa, Hadramout, Mahra and Lahj.
It pointed out that the weather in the coastal areas would be clear to partly cloudy, with the possibility of light rain falling on parts of the eastern coasts.
The center noted that the winds might be very strong in the Socotra Archipelago, in the Gulf of Aden, and on the eastern and southern coasts.
It warned citizens in mountainous areas where rainfall expected to be caution, to avoid thunderstorms and also to avoid crossing floodwaters during and after rainfall.
